NEW YORK (AFX) - Data center services provider Equinix Inc. said Wednesday in a regulatory filing that the U.S. Attorney for the Northern District of California withdrew its grand jury subpoena requesting documents relating to Equinix's stock option grants and practices.As reported, the Securities and Exchange Commission in December terminated its investigation of Equinix's stock option grants without recommending any enforcement action. The company received an informal inquiry from the SEC in June.The company completed an internal review in August 2006. Equinix is one of about 200 companies that have disclosed federal or internal investigations into their stock options grants.Shares fell 37 cents to $81.70 in afternoon trading on the Nasdaq.Copyright 2006 Associated Press.
